KITTIE and GOD FORBID – TOUR DATE SCHEDULE – NORTH AMERICA!

3/3/10 – Toronto, ON. Opera House
3/4/10 – Mar Montreal, QC. Underworld
3/6/10 – Sayreville, NJ. Starland Ballroom
3/7/10 – Raleigh, NC. Volume 11
3/8/10 – Allentown, PA. Crocodile Rock
3/10/10 – Huntington, WV. V Club
3/11/10 – Covington, KY. Mad Hatter
3/14/10 – Milwaukee, WI. The Rave
3/16/10 – Waterloo, IA. Spicoli’s Rock Garden
3/19/10 – Columbus, OH. Al Rosa Villa
3/20/10 – Flint, MI. Machine Shop
3/21/10 – Cleveland, OH. Peabodys
3/23/10 – New York, NY. BB Kings
3/24/10 – Foxborough, MA. Showcase Live
3/25/10 – Nashua, NH. Amber Room
3/26/10 – Orono, ME. Ultra Lounge
3/27/10 – Poughkeepsie, NY. The Chance

Kittie “Spit” is one huge chunk, of an extremely heavy work of Metal. I basically stumbled onto this CD courtesy of a local thrift store that I love to frequent – for Metal finds, of course. “Spit” only set me back 3 bucks, not too shabby for a Metal find. If you are into Death Metal, Hardcore and Extreme Metal, well, “Spit” should be in your Metal collection. Very heavy music here, seriously heavy. Heavy duty heavy. The lyrics are heavy. Everything about Kittie and “Spit” is Metal, of the extreme. Morgan Lander on vocals and guitar has the attitude bellowing with unashamed aggression. Morgan’s Death Metal vocals definitely get across loud and loud again. After listening to Morgan Lander sing, I would not want to be the dude that ever crosses her, in any way. Listening to all 12 songs will have you knowing that Kittie is not looking for commercial approval or a top 100 hit single. Kittie are playing the heaviest of Metal and delivering it like a cosmic meteor storm. I love Metal and respect what Kittie had created with “Spit”. This album has become one of my underground Metal favorites. This is a disc worth exploring if you are into the heaviest of Metal.

The enhanced CD version of “Spit” has a full screen video of the song “Brackish”. The Kittie lineup for “Spit” was: Morgan Lander on vocals & guitar, Mercedes Lander on drums, Talena Atfield on bass and Fallon Bowman on guitar. Kittie “Spit” was released on January 11, 2000. Going on a decade since it’s release, this Metal from Kittie measures up to todays Metal standard of heavy.
